Paying for New Healthcare Plan
I see that Senator Baucus is about to solve the issue of paying for healthcare reform—he wants to tax the insurance companies! Perhaps he is following the lead of Oregon Governor Kulongoski, who recently signed into law a new tax on health insurance companies operating in Oregon…in order to help pay for the “Oregon Plan.”
Needless to say, the Oregon health insurance companies immediately passed every penny of the new tax onto their insured through increases in premiums. What are these politicians thinking? Don’t they understand that taxing the insurance companies is simply taxing the insured through increased premiums?
This type of thinking is what is driving the small business person crazy—they don’t know what to think, or do, but many of those who have health insurance programs in place for their employees are certain that they will likely be dropping, or reducing, those plans. So, what is the government gaining if they price insurance premiums out of reach of small business?
